What Are the Most Common Commercial Applications of Drones?

The most common commercial applications of drones include:

  • Aerial Photography and Videography: Drones are widely used in the film and photography industry for capturing stunning aerial shots that were previously difficult or expensive to obtain.
  • Agricultural Monitoring: Farmers utilize drones to monitor crop health, assess irrigation needs, and manage livestock, providing real-time data that helps optimize yield and reduce waste.
  • Infrastructure Inspection: Drones can inspect hard-to-reach infrastructure such as bridges, power lines, and wind turbines, allowing for safer and more efficient assessments without the need for scaffolding or cranes.
  • Delivery Services: Companies are exploring drone delivery for small packages, which can significantly reduce delivery times and costs, particularly in urban areas.
  • Search and Rescue Operations: Drones equipped with thermal imaging and high-resolution cameras are employed in search and rescue missions, helping locate missing persons or assess disaster-stricken areas quickly.
  • Mining and Excavation: Drones are used in the mining industry for surveying and mapping, providing accurate topographic data that can enhance operational efficiency and safety.
  • Real Estate Marketing: Real estate agents use drones to create immersive property videos and aerial maps, giving potential buyers a better understanding of the property and its surroundings.
  • Environmental Monitoring: Drones help monitor various environmental factors such as wildlife populations, deforestation, and pollution levels, supporting conservation efforts and regulatory compliance.

How Are Drones Revolutionizing Agricultural Practices?

Drones are revolutionizing agricultural practices by enhancing efficiency, precision, and data collection capabilities.

  • Crop Monitoring: Drones equipped with cameras and sensors allow farmers to monitor crop health in real-time. This technology helps in identifying issues such as pest infestations or nutrient deficiencies early, enabling timely interventions that can save crops and increase yields.
  • Aerial Mapping: Drones can create high-resolution maps of farmland through photogrammetry and multispectral imaging. These maps provide farmers with detailed insights into soil composition and crop variability, aiding in better planning and resource allocation.
  • Irrigation Management: By using thermal imaging cameras, drones can assess moisture levels in the soil and identify areas that require irrigation. This leads to more efficient water use, reducing waste and ensuring crops receive the optimal amount of moisture.
  • Pesticide and Fertilizer Application: Drones can be programmed to spray pesticides and fertilizers precisely where needed, minimizing chemical use and reducing environmental impact. This targeted application not only lowers costs but also improves crop safety and quality.
  • Livestock Monitoring: Drones can be employed to oversee livestock movements and health from the air, which is particularly useful for large farms. This technology helps farmers keep track of their animals, ensuring they are healthy and in the right locations without the need for constant ground checking.
  • Field Surveying: Drones can quickly survey large areas of farmland, collecting data that would take days for traditional methods. This rapid data collection aids in making informed decisions about planting schedules, harvesting times, and land management practices.

In What Ways Are Drones Used for Infrastructure Inspections?

Drones have become invaluable tools for infrastructure inspections, offering efficiency and safety while providing high-quality data. The best uses for drones in this context include:

  • Bridge Inspections: Drones can quickly survey bridges from various angles, capturing detailed images and videos that reveal cracks, corrosion, or structural weaknesses. This method reduces the need for scaffolding and allows for inspections in hard-to-reach areas, ultimately saving time and costs.
  • Power Line Monitoring: Equipped with thermal imaging and high-resolution cameras, drones can monitor power lines for insulation damage, overheating, and vegetation encroachment. This proactive approach enables utility companies to address issues before they lead to outages or safety hazards.
  • Roof Inspections: Drones can safely inspect rooftops, particularly on tall or complex structures, providing aerial views that identify damage or wear without the risk of sending personnel onto potentially unsafe surfaces. This capability is especially useful for assessing commercial buildings and residential homes after severe weather events.
  • Pipeline Inspections: Drones equipped with specialized sensors can detect leaks and assess the condition of pipelines running through difficult terrains. This method enhances safety by reducing the need for ground crews to access hazardous areas while ensuring compliance with regulatory standards.
  • Railway Track Inspections: Drones can efficiently survey railway tracks for obstructions or structural issues, allowing for timely maintenance and reducing the risk of accidents. With the ability to cover large areas quickly, these inspections can be performed regularly to maintain operational safety.
  • Construction Site Monitoring: Drones provide ongoing oversight of construction sites, offering real-time data on progress, safety compliance, and potential issues. This capability helps project managers make informed decisions and reduces the likelihood of costly delays.
  • Dam Inspections: Drones can inspect the structural integrity of dams, monitoring for signs of erosion, leakage, or other vulnerabilities. This aerial perspective allows for a comprehensive assessment that might be challenging to achieve from ground level.

How Are Drones Enhancing Public Safety and Law Enforcement?

Drones are revolutionizing public safety and law enforcement in various impactful ways, providing innovative solutions to complex challenges.

  • Search and Rescue Operations: Drones are deployed in search and rescue missions to locate missing persons in difficult terrains.
  • Traffic Monitoring: Law enforcement agencies use drones to monitor traffic conditions and manage congestion effectively.
  • Crime Scene Investigation: Drones aid in documenting crime scenes from aerial perspectives, providing crucial evidence for investigations.
  • Disaster Response: Drones are utilized to assess damage and coordinate emergency response efforts during natural disasters.
  • Surveillance and Patrol: Drones enhance surveillance capabilities, allowing for real-time monitoring of public spaces and potential criminal activities.

Search and rescue operations benefit significantly from drones, as they can cover large areas quickly and access hard-to-reach locations, such as forests or mountains, where traditional ground teams may struggle.

Traffic monitoring through drones allows law enforcement to oversee and analyze traffic flow, accidents, and incidents from above, enabling them to respond promptly and effectively to maintain public safety.

In crime scene investigations, drones provide high-resolution aerial imagery that can capture the entire scene’s layout, which is invaluable for reconstructing events and helping detectives gather evidence.

During disaster response scenarios, drones are employed to survey affected areas, enabling emergency responders to identify hazards, assess structural damage, and prioritize rescue operations based on real-time data.

Surveillance and patrol missions benefit from drones, which can patrol large urban areas more efficiently than ground units, providing law enforcement with vital information about suspicious activities and ensuring quicker response times to incidents.

What Role Do Drones Play in Disaster Response and Rescue Operations?

Drones play a crucial role in enhancing disaster response and rescue operations in various ways:

  • Damage Assessment: Drones equipped with high-resolution cameras can quickly survey disaster-stricken areas to assess damage. This aerial perspective allows responders to identify affected structures and prioritize areas needing immediate support, significantly speeding up the evaluation process.
  • Search and Rescue Operations: Drones can be deployed to locate missing persons in hard-to-reach areas, using thermal imaging technology to detect heat signatures. This capability is especially vital during natural disasters, where traditional search methods may be hindered by debris or hazardous conditions.
  • Delivery of Supplies: Drones can transport essential supplies such as food, water, and medical kits to isolated or inaccessible locations. This can be critical in the early stages of a disaster, where ground access might be blocked, ensuring that affected individuals receive necessary resources quickly.
  • Real-Time Data Collection: Drones facilitate the gathering of real-time data regarding weather conditions, terrain, and potential hazards. This information aids emergency management teams in making informed decisions and adjusting their strategies as the situation evolves.
  • Communication Relay: In the aftermath of a disaster, communication networks may be compromised. Drones can act as temporary communication relays, enabling responders to maintain contact with each other and coordinate efforts effectively across affected regions.
  • Environmental Monitoring: Drones can monitor environmental changes post-disaster, such as flooding or landslides, to provide ongoing assessments of safety and risk. This monitoring helps in planning recovery efforts and mitigating further hazards.

How Are Drones Transforming Aerial Photography and Filmmaking?

Drones are revolutionizing aerial photography and filmmaking by providing unique perspectives and capabilities that were previously difficult or expensive to achieve.

  • Real Estate Photography: Drones are extensively used in real estate to capture stunning aerial shots of properties. This allows potential buyers to see the layout of the land, surrounding areas, and overall property size, making listings more appealing.
  • Event Coverage: Drones can capture large-scale events such as weddings, concerts, and festivals from unique angles. This aerial perspective adds a dynamic element to event documentation, allowing videographers to capture sweeping views of the venue and the crowd.
  • Filmmaking: In the film industry, drones have become essential tools for capturing cinematic shots that enhance storytelling. They can achieve complex camera movements and high-altitude shots that would otherwise require expensive rigging or helicopters.
  • Nature and Wildlife Photography: Drones provide a non-intrusive way to capture nature and wildlife in their natural habitats. This allows photographers and filmmakers to document behaviors and scenes without disturbing the animals, resulting in more authentic footage.
  • Inspection and Surveying: Drones are utilized for inspecting hard-to-reach structures like bridges, power lines, and wind turbines. Aerial photography from drones aids in identifying maintenance needs and surveying areas efficiently, providing detailed visual data to engineers and inspectors.
  • Sports and Action Shots: Drones are increasingly used in sports to capture fast-paced action from above. This capability allows for innovative angles and perspectives that enrich sports broadcasts and highlight reels, providing viewers with an immersive experience.
  • Travel Videography: Travelers and content creators use drones to document their journeys from breathtaking viewpoints. Drones can showcase landscapes and landmarks in a way that standard cameras cannot, making travel videos more engaging and visually stunning.

What Are the Benefits of Using Drones for Delivery Services?

The benefits of using drones for delivery services include improved efficiency, cost-effectiveness, and enhanced accessibility.

  • Speed: Drones can significantly reduce delivery times compared to traditional methods.
  • Cost Reduction: Utilizing drones for deliveries can lower operational costs by minimizing labor and fuel expenses.
  • Accessibility: Drones can reach remote or hard-to-access areas that may be challenging for ground vehicles.
  • Reduced Traffic Impact: Drones can bypass road congestion, resulting in more timely deliveries and less stress on urban transport systems.
  • Environmental Benefits: Drones often have a smaller carbon footprint compared to conventional delivery vehicles.

Speed: Drones can deliver packages in a fraction of the time it takes for traditional delivery services. They fly directly to their destination, avoiding traffic and other delays that often plague ground transport.

Cost Reduction: By minimizing the need for a large workforce and reducing fuel costs associated with delivery trucks, drones can help businesses save money. This efficiency can translate to lower prices for consumers and higher profit margins for companies.

Accessibility: Drones are particularly useful for delivering items to rural or isolated locations where traditional delivery services may struggle. Their ability to fly over obstacles makes them ideal for reaching customers in challenging terrains.

Reduced Traffic Impact: Drones operate independently of roadways, which means they can avoid traffic jams and other hindrances that slow down ground deliveries. This capability not only enhances delivery efficiency but also alleviates pressure on city infrastructure.

Environmental Benefits: Drones typically consume less energy compared to gasoline-powered delivery vehicles, contributing to a reduction in greenhouse gas emissions. Their use can promote sustainable delivery practices, aligning with increasing consumer demand for eco-friendly solutions.
